Just like you wish to avoid late fees, be sure to avoid the fee for being over the limit too. Both are expensive fees and exceeding your limit can also hurt your credit score. This is a very good reason to always be careful not to exceed your limit.
It is necessary for you to sign any credit card as soon as you receive it. A lot of people do not and this can make you a victim of fraud, since the cashier will not know it is not you. The signature on the back offers protection against fraudulent purchases because the cashier verifies that the customer’s signature matches the signature on the card.

Be sure you check regularly to see if anything in your conditions and terms changes. It is common for companies to change credit terms very often. Often, the changes that most affect you are buried in legal language. Weigh all the information and research what it means to you. Rate adjustments or new fees can really impact your account.
Just because you made a purchase, does not mean you should immediately pay it off the moment you return home. Instead, pay off the balance when the statement arrives. This shows a good payment history and enhances your credit score as well.

Once you acquire a credit card, you should work to keep it active for the longest period possible. Don’t switch to another credit card account unless you really have to. Your credit score is affected by the overall duration of your account history. Another element to establishing credit is to maintain and keep you credit accounts open and active at all times.
Never put your credit card details in a fax to someone, ever. Faxes sit in offices for hours on end, and an entire office full of people will have free access to all of your personal information. If any of those people is a thief, you are in trouble. This leaves you wide open to fraud and the financial headaches associated with it.
Watch each of your credit transactions carefully. You can also get mobile alerts. These alerts will notify you of any irregular activity so you can contact the company immediately. If you see any such illicit activity, call your bank immediately or even the police if applicable.

Lots of credit card companies give bonuses for when you sign up for new credit cards. Make sure that you understand everything that is written in fine print since many credit card companies have specific terms you need to adhere to in order to get bonuses. These terms commonly stipulate that must spend a given amount within a certain time-frame in order to qualify. If you don’t think that you can meet the terms of the offer, it might not make sense to sign up for the card.
Check out the types of loyalty rewards and bonuses that a credit card company is offering. Look for these highly beneficial loyalty programs that may apply to any credit card you use on a regular basis. Over time, the perks add up and will give you some great additional income or discounts.
If you wish to get a credit card that has great rates and benefits, keep an eye on your credit score. The credit card issuing agents use your credit score to determine the interest rates and incentives they will offer you in a card. Most of the time, cards with the lowest interest rates and bonus features are offered to those with the best credit scores.

If your mailbox does not contain a lock, do not order cards through the mail. Credit card thieves see unlocked mailboxes as a treasure trove of credit information.
Don’t make a written record of your credit card’s PIN or password. It’s crucial to remember all of your passwords so you’re the only one who can access your accounts. Writing down your PIN, especially if you store it with your card, can put your account in jeopardy if the information falls into the wrong hands.
